**Vendor note: Inkmill markdown pipeline**

Rendering for Parchway docs is outsourced to Inkmill under an annual contract, renewing each March. They handle sanitization and PDF export; we own the upload queue. SLA: 4-hour response on rendering failures. Escalate only after two failed retries. Their support desk is reachable at the address below.

billing contact of hahaf-baguf = zorael.tammir.jorius@sivrelhq.internal

Spriteweld 4.0 updates the default behavior of component snapshot tests. Snapshots are now serialized deterministically, animation frames are frozen at render time, and theme tokens are inlined rather than referenced. Plugin authors: existing snapshots will fail once on upgrade; regenerate them with the refresh command and commit the diff. Obsolete snapshot files are pruned automatically. If your plugin overrides the test harness, confirm compatibility before publishing. The new default configuration values are listed below.

config for hahaf-kafof:
[wenys]
host = wenys.torvahq.corp
user = wenys_svc
database = wenys_prod

- [ ] **Step 7: Breaker override escrow.** After sealing the signing keys for the Tallgrove upstream API circuit breaker, confirm the support team can force the breaker open during a full outage. The override bundle lives in the sealed escrow drawer and is useless without its unlock phrase. Two ceremony witnesses must initial this step before proceeding. The escrow bundle is decrypted with the recovery passphrase that follows.

vault phrase of kahip-kahop = holath-quenmir

Leadership Review Briefing — Gross Margin

Gross margin at Faldane Systems slipped to 41.2%, down 1.8 points, driven by input costs on the Orvet line and freight out of the Pellworth plant. Mitigations: repricing in two tiers and a supplier consolidation led by R. Stenmark. Heads of department should note the confidential item appended below.

board note of bawep-tajef: Queniusek Systems plans to raise the Quenvan list price by 53.1 percent in March. The pricing group signed off on a budget of $176.4 million for Project Drueth. The renewal with Casionix Partners closes at $142.5 million a year, 8.3 percent below the last contract. Project Fraax slips by six weeks because of the tooling delay.